{"id":"https://openalex.org/W1969926570","doi":"https://doi.org/10.1145/2601248.2601278","title":"A systematic literature review of traceability approaches between software architecture and source code","display_name":"A systematic literature review of traceability approaches between software architecture and source code","publication_year":2014,"publication_date":"2014-05-13","ids":{"openalex":"https://openalex.org/W1969926570","doi":"https://doi.org/10.1145/2601248.2601278","mag":"1969926570"},"language":"en","primary_location":{"id":"doi:10.1145/2601248.2601278","is_oa":false,"landing_page_url":"https://doi.org/10.1145/2601248.2601278","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the 18th International Conference on Evaluation and Assessment in Software Engineering","raw_type":"proceedings-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":false,"oa_status":"closed","oa_url":null,"any_repository_has_fulltext":false},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5102808658","display_name":"Muhammad Atif Javed","orcid":"https://orcid.org/0000-0003-3781-4756"},"institutions":[{"id":"https://openalex.org/I129774422","display_name":"University of Vienna","ror":"https://ror.org/03prydq77","country_code":"AT","type":"education","lineage":["https://openalex.org/I129774422"]}],"countries":["AT"],"is_corresponding":true,"raw_author_name":"Muhammad Atif Javed","raw_affiliation_strings":["University of Vienna, Austria"],"affiliations":[{"raw_affiliation_string":"University of Vienna, Austria","institution_ids":["https://openalex.org/I129774422"]}]},{"author_position":"last","author":{"id":"https://openalex.org/A5077943544","display_name":"Uwe Zdun","orcid":"https://orcid.org/0000-0002-6233-2591"},"institutions":[{"id":"https://openalex.org/I129774422","display_name":"University of Vienna","ror":"https://ror.org/03prydq77","country_code":"AT","type":"education","lineage":["https://openalex.org/I129774422"]}],"countries":["AT"],"is_corresponding":false,"raw_author_name":"Uwe Zdun","raw_affiliation_strings":["University of Vienna, Austria"],"affiliations":[{"raw_affiliation_string":"University of Vienna, Austria","institution_ids":["https://openalex.org/I129774422"]}]}],"institutions":[],"countries_distinct_count":1,"institutions_distinct_count":2,"corresponding_author_ids":["https://openalex.org/A5102808658"],"corresponding_institution_ids":["https://openalex.org/I129774422"],"apc_list":null,"apc_paid":null,"fwci":8.2289,"has_fulltext":false,"cited_by_count":44,"citation_normalized_percentile":{"value":0.97034004,"is_in_top_1_percent":false,"is_in_top_10_percent":true},"cited_by_percentile_year":{"min":89,"max":98},"biblio":{"volume":null,"issue":null,"first_page":"1","last_page":"10"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T10260","display_name":"Software Engineering Research","score":0.9998000264167786,"subfield":{"id":"https://openalex.org/subfields/1710","display_name":"Information Systems"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},"topics":[{"id":"https://openalex.org/T10260","display_name":"Software Engineering Research","score":0.9998000264167786,"subfield":{"id":"https://openalex.org/subfields/1710","display_name":"Information Systems"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T10639","display_name":"Advanced Software Engineering Methodologies","score":0.9988999962806702,"subfield":{"id":"https://openalex.org/subfields/1702","display_name":"Artificial Intelligence"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T12423","display_name":"Software Reliability and Analysis Research","score":0.9987000226974487,"subfield":{"id":"https://openalex.org/subfields/1712","display_name":"Software"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/traceability","display_name":"Traceability","score":0.8552869558334351},{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.7097181081771851},{"id":"https://openalex.org/keywords/software-engineering","display_name":"Software engineering","score":0.7082709074020386},{"id":"https://openalex.org/keywords/code-review","display_name":"Code review","score":0.6297490000724792},{"id":"https://openalex.org/keywords/software-architecture","display_name":"Software architecture","score":0.5513262748718262},{"id":"https://openalex.org/keywords/reference-architecture","display_name":"Reference architecture","score":0.5117809176445007},{"id":"https://openalex.org/keywords/source-code","display_name":"Source code","score":0.5075377225875854},{"id":"https://openalex.org/keywords/software-quality","display_name":"Software quality","score":0.5035108923912048},{"id":"https://openalex.org/keywords/software-system","display_name":"Software system","score":0.4245091378688812},{"id":"https://openalex.org/keywords/software-construction","display_name":"Software construction","score":0.41921138763427734},{"id":"https://openalex.org/keywords/software-peer-review","display_name":"Software peer review","score":0.415761262178421},{"id":"https://openalex.org/keywords/software-development","display_name":"Software development","score":0.39180561900138855},{"id":"https://openalex.org/keywords/software","display_name":"Software","score":0.3713955283164978},{"id":"https://openalex.org/keywords/programming-language","display_name":"Programming language","score":0.15448853373527527}],"concepts":[{"id":"https://openalex.org/C153876917","wikidata":"https://www.wikidata.org/wiki/Q899704","display_name":"Traceability","level":2,"score":0.8552869558334351},{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.7097181081771851},{"id":"https://openalex.org/C115903868","wikidata":"https://www.wikidata.org/wiki/Q80993","display_name":"Software engineering","level":1,"score":0.7082709074020386},{"id":"https://openalex.org/C150292731","wikidata":"https://www.wikidata.org/wiki/Q1342704","display_name":"Code review","level":5,"score":0.6297490000724792},{"id":"https://openalex.org/C35869016","wikidata":"https://www.wikidata.org/wiki/Q846636","display_name":"Software architecture","level":3,"score":0.5513262748718262},{"id":"https://openalex.org/C55356503","wikidata":"https://www.wikidata.org/wiki/Q2136675","display_name":"Reference architecture","level":4,"score":0.5117809176445007},{"id":"https://openalex.org/C43126263","wikidata":"https://www.wikidata.org/wiki/Q128751","display_name":"Source code","level":2,"score":0.5075377225875854},{"id":"https://openalex.org/C117447612","wikidata":"https://www.wikidata.org/wiki/Q1412670","display_name":"Software quality","level":4,"score":0.5035108923912048},{"id":"https://openalex.org/C149091818","wikidata":"https://www.wikidata.org/wiki/Q2429814","display_name":"Software system","level":3,"score":0.4245091378688812},{"id":"https://openalex.org/C186846655","wikidata":"https://www.wikidata.org/wiki/Q3398377","display_name":"Software construction","level":4,"score":0.41921138763427734},{"id":"https://openalex.org/C74579156","wikidata":"https://www.wikidata.org/wiki/Q7554342","display_name":"Software peer review","level":5,"score":0.415761262178421},{"id":"https://openalex.org/C529173508","wikidata":"https://www.wikidata.org/wiki/Q638608","display_name":"Software development","level":3,"score":0.39180561900138855},{"id":"https://openalex.org/C2777904410","wikidata":"https://www.wikidata.org/wiki/Q7397","display_name":"Software","level":2,"score":0.3713955283164978},{"id":"https://openalex.org/C199360897","wikidata":"https://www.wikidata.org/wiki/Q9143","display_name":"Programming language","level":1,"score":0.15448853373527527}],"mesh":[],"locations_count":1,"locations":[{"id":"doi:10.1145/2601248.2601278","is_oa":false,"landing_page_url":"https://doi.org/10.1145/2601248.2601278","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the 18th International Conference on Evaluation and Assessment in Software Engineering","raw_type":"proceedings-article"}],"best_oa_location":null,"sustainable_development_goals":[{"display_name":"Reduced inequalities","id":"https://metadata.un.org/sdg/10","score":0.7699999809265137}],"awards":[{"id":"https://openalex.org/G3432305038","display_name":null,"funder_award_id":"P24345-N23","funder_id":"https://openalex.org/F4320321181","funder_display_name":"Austrian Science Fund"}],"funders":[{"id":"https://openalex.org/F4320321181","display_name":"Austrian Science Fund","ror":"https://ror.org/013tf3c58"}],"has_content":{"pdf":false,"grobid_xml":false},"content_urls":null,"referenced_works_count":24,"referenced_works":["https://openalex.org/W1555930296","https://openalex.org/W1649645444","https://openalex.org/W1800478330","https://openalex.org/W1973150126","https://openalex.org/W1976019047","https://openalex.org/W2035661562","https://openalex.org/W2056449974","https://openalex.org/W2061643308","https://openalex.org/W2071604149","https://openalex.org/W2083423422","https://openalex.org/W2099358823","https://openalex.org/W2106956101","https://openalex.org/W2107548688","https://openalex.org/W2109773497","https://openalex.org/W2114250043","https://openalex.org/W2121792234","https://openalex.org/W2150873955","https://openalex.org/W2151168338","https://openalex.org/W2157960915","https://openalex.org/W2160608820","https://openalex.org/W2166568068","https://openalex.org/W2170890922","https://openalex.org/W2752885492","https://openalex.org/W3145128584"],"related_works":["https://openalex.org/W2047206966","https://openalex.org/W1583260306","https://openalex.org/W2053107757","https://openalex.org/W2017266164","https://openalex.org/W1152672851","https://openalex.org/W1552148294","https://openalex.org/W2354797847","https://openalex.org/W2056489237","https://openalex.org/W174255016","https://openalex.org/W2124684568"],"abstract_inverted_index":{"The":[0,138],"links":[1],"between":[2,41,76,182],"the":[3,7,31,70,85,107,112,124,133,171,174,198],"software":[4,12,32,42,77,98,183],"architecture":[5,43,78,99,184],"and":[6,28,44,74,79,93,101,104,164,180,185,192,212],"source":[8,45,80,186],"code":[9,46],"of":[10,30,106,127,145,173,177,221,225],"a":[11,208,216],"system":[13],"should":[14],"be":[15],"based":[16],"on":[17,39],"solid":[18],"traceability":[19,40,72,178],"mechanisms":[20],"in":[21,136,151,170,202],"order":[22],"to":[23,68,97,115,122,157,214,227],"effectively":[24],"perform":[25],"quality":[26],"control":[27],"maintenance":[29],"system.":[33],"There":[34],"are":[35],"several":[36],"primary":[37],"studies":[38],"but":[47],"so":[48],"far":[49],"no":[50],"systematic":[51],"literature":[52],"review":[53],"(SLR)":[54],"has":[55,64,118],"been":[56,65,119,149],"undertaken.":[57],"This":[58],"study":[59],"presents":[60],"an":[61],"SLR":[62,111,168],"which":[63,146],"carried":[66],"out":[67,144],"discover":[69],"existing":[71],"approaches":[73,179,222],"tools":[75,181],"code,":[81,187],"as":[82,84,188,190,207],"well":[83,189],"empirical":[86],"evidence":[87],"for":[88,194,210],"these":[89],"approaches,":[90],"their":[91,95],"benefits":[92],"liabilities,":[94],"relations":[96],"understanding,":[100],"issues,":[102],"barriers,":[103],"challenges":[105],"approaches.":[108],"In":[109],"our":[110,152,162],"ACM":[113],"Guide":[114],"Computing":[116],"Literature":[117],"electronically":[120],"searched":[121],"accumulate":[123],"biggest":[125],"share":[126],"relevant":[128],"scientific":[129],"bibliographic":[130],"citations":[131],"from":[132,155],"major":[134],"publishers":[135],"computing.":[137],"search":[139],"strategy":[140],"identified":[141],"742":[142],"citations,":[143],"11":[147],"have":[148],"included":[150],"study,":[153],"dated":[154],"1999":[156],"July,":[158],"2013,":[159],"after":[160],"applying":[161],"inclusion":[163],"exclusion":[165],"criteria.":[166],"Our":[167],"resulted":[169],"identification":[172],"current":[175],"state-of-the-art":[176],"gaps":[191],"pointers":[193],"further":[195],"research.":[196],"Moreover,":[197],"classification":[199],"scheme":[200],"developed":[201],"this":[203],"paper":[204],"can":[205],"serve":[206],"guide":[209],"researchers":[211],"practitioners":[213],"find":[215],"specific":[217],"approach":[218],"or":[219],"set":[220],"that":[223],"is":[224],"interest":[226],"them.":[228]},"counts_by_year":[{"year":2025,"cited_by_count":3},{"year":2024,"cited_by_count":3},{"year":2023,"cited_by_count":6},{"year":2022,"cited_by_count":6},{"year":2021,"cited_by_count":6},{"year":2020,"cited_by_count":3},{"year":2019,"cited_by_count":3},{"year":2018,"cited_by_count":4},{"year":2017,"cited_by_count":4},{"year":2016,"cited_by_count":4},{"year":2015,"cited_by_count":1},{"year":2014,"cited_by_count":1}],"updated_date":"2026-03-27T05:58:40.876381","created_date":"2025-10-10T00:00:00"}
